Roanoke: Lead Risk & Vulnerable Populations

0.003
mg/L Avg Lead (Limit: 0.015)

Why children are most at risk: The CDC states there is no safe level of lead exposure for children. Children under 6 absorb lead more readily than adults, and even low levels can cause developmental delays, learning difficulties, and behavioral problems.

Lead risk in Roanoke appears low overall, but individual homes may differ. Testing is the only way to confirm your water's lead content.

Historical NFIP data for Roanoke contains 62 flood insurance claims. Among claims with payment data, the average reported building, contents, and ICC component sum is $34,510. Among ZIP codes with claim records, 0% have an A- or V-family dominant rated zone recorded in those historical claims. This is not a complete current FEMA property-map inventory.

How flooding affects water quality: Flood events can introduce sewage, agricultural runoff, and industrial chemicals into water supplies. Even after floodwaters recede, contamination can persist in wells and aging infrastructure. Does Roanoke water have lead?
The average 90th-percentile lead level in Roanoke is 0.003 mg/L. This is below the EPA action level of 0.015 mg/L. Lead levels can vary by home - testing is recommended especially in older properties.
